Many of you may wonder how and what to do with the money you save on Hypermiling.  Even though integrating 3 mpg - 6 mpg saved due to great hypermiling skills, you may be surprised that it is a slight bit tricky to "see the money in your pocket".  This is a prototype, but i hope this will help put that money saved at the pump in your budget.

2 things:  1.  I am heavily influenced by approaches of Dave Ramsey towards budgeting.  Google him if you need help with these ideas.  It's really a great system.
2.  FORTUNATELY due to gas being low at the time of writing ($2.39 in my hometown) i am analyzing a Scenario 1 and Scenario 2.  Scenario 1 is where we are now.  Hypermiling is important but not as important as when gas is $4 a gallon or more.  Scenario 1 looks at what i call my "threshold" of pain before the price is up there.  that threshold is for now at $2.87  Since 2.87-2.39 = 48 cents, it is nice to be below that threshold of pain, and that means you can "save" about 48 cents/gallon.  More to come on budgeting, but an easy way to use that 48 cents is to put it into your savings account. 

SCENARIO 1:  Price of Gas:  $2.39
Money saved below threshold (which is $2.87) 48 cents/gallon

est 15 gallons of gas used per month means $7.20 / month saved due to "wonderfulness of being below threshold".

SCENARIO 2:  Hypermiling replaces threshold bonus
Price of Gas:  $4.00
Money saved below threshold ($2.87) is ZERO
Money saved hypermiling 3 mpg up to 6 mpg bonus = 4.4cents/gallon - 8.8cents/gallon

est 15 gallons of gas used per month means 66 cents- $1. 36  saved per month, no "wonderfullness" but due to Hypermiling techniques.

I compute the hypermiling bonus based on getting 27mpg avg. before hypermiling, then adding 3 mpg-6mpg is a 1.1-2.2% increase.
